Transaction 583cd30f2a2322c0789b27efe254095392ecbe5944411f33f68fa3619d04dee5
1 Input
1 Output
-
583cd30f2a2322c0789b27efe254095392ecbe5944411f33f68fa3619d04dee5:0
- value
- 1839168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e51c57cc86bdc77ce0d8dff1b172b9f9485d5a0 OP_EQUAL
- address
- 35uvxwsZcKFQqE1H8JSXzux7cAXjbuyd7e